India's animal husbandry sector is evolving rapidly, and AHIDF aims to create modern infrastructure in dairy, meat processing, feed manufacturing and allied sectors.
Eligible entities can access loan + subsidy support, including startups, MSMEs, FPOs and private companies.
Key Benefits & Subsidy Breakdown
Loan Coverage
Up to 90% of project cost.
Interest Subvention
3% (up to 8 years).
Credit Guarantee
25% guarantee through NABARD.
Moratorium
2 years on principal.
AHIDF Scheme Eligibility
FPOs, Private Companies, MSMEs, Startups, Section 8 Companies, and Individual entrepreneurs.
Documents Required for AHIDF Loan
Keep the following documents ready for AHIDF application and review.
- Detailed Project Report (DPR)
- Machinery layout & process flow
- Project viability & financial projections
- SWOT analysis
- Land title / lease agreement
- Applicant Aadhaar + PAN
- Incorporation / partnership documents
- Udyam registration (if MSME)
- Audited accounts and financial statements
